Modifiers
Modifiers allow you to customise orders by offering add-ons, removals, or substitutions. For example, customers may want to add cheese, remove an ingredient, or switch to a vegan option.
All modifier sets are listed in alphabetical order for easy navigation. Unlike categories, these sets cannot be reordered manually.

Modifiers in the Set
Each modifier in a set can be viewed and edited. For every modifier, you can specify the name, availability status, quantity, and price.
There are four toggle settings available for modifiers within a modifier set:
Track Inventory
When enabled, each modifier has a finite quantity that decreases as it is used in orders
(e.g., “Only 10 sesame bagels left”).Limit One
Restricts the product to only one modifier selection during purchase
(e.g., choosing a bagel flavour).Required
Ensures a modifier must be selected before the product can be added to the cart
(e.g., choosing the size of a coffee).Reorder
Allows modifiers within the set to be rearranged for display on the store page.
When this toggle is on, modifiers can be dragged into a new order, but they cannot be opened for editing.
To edit a modifier, make sure to switch this toggle off first.

Product Associations
At the bottom of each modifier set, you’ll see a list of all products that currently use that set. This makes it easy to see which products are linked and to update or remove the association.
You can click on any product in the list to review and adjust whether the modifier set is active for that product. 

Managing Modifer from Bridge
In the Menu section you can edit the modifier sets and modifiers.
Within each set, there are several toggles available to control how the modifiers behave:
The Track Inventory toggle enables you to track the quantity of each individual modifier. This is useful for items like specific bagel types or add-ons that have limited stock.
The Limit One toggle ensures that customers can only choose one modifier from the set — for example, allowing them to choose just one bagel flavour.
The Required toggle makes the modifier set mandatory during ordering. This means the customer must choose an option before completing the transaction.
